Assistant Blacksmith

Part-time (Entry level)

Axcadmy is a hands-on blacksmithing studio offering immersive axe, knife, and metalworking workshops for beginners, groups, and corporate teams. We’re looking for a part-time Assistant Blacksmith to support our workshops and learn the craft in a fast-paced, hands-on environment.

This is the starting point for most team members. You’ll work closely with the instructors to support participants, keep the workshop running smoothly, and build your skills over time.

Training is provided.

What You’ll Do

Workshop Support

  • Support instructors during workshops

  • Assist participants one-on-one during forging

  • Reinforce instructions and help participants stay on track

  • Step in to support participants who need extra guidance

Setup, Cleanup & Flow

  • Set up tools, materials, and workstations before workshops

  • Handle cleanup and reset between and after sessions

  • Keep stations organized and ready throughout the workshop

  • Help maintain a smooth flow from start to finish

Safety & Awareness

  • Monitor participants during active workshops

  • Flag safety concerns or risks immediately

  • Help maintain a clean, safe, and controlled environment at all times

Studio Organization & Supplies

  • Help keep tools, materials, and shared spaces organized

  • Monitor supplies and flag when items are running low, including:

    • First aid supplies

    • Water and safety gear

    • Metal stock and consumables

  • Support basic shop organization and upkeep

 

What We’re Looking For

Experience

  • Basic experience with Jewelry making, blacksmithing, metalworking, or related hands-on trades

  • Comfort working with tools, heat, and physical materials

  • Willingness to learn Axcadmy’s tools, workflows, and teaching style

 

Approach

  • Clear and direct communicator

  • Approachable and calm in a group setting

  • Attentive and aware of what’s happening around you

  • Comfortable teaching beginners and working with a wide range of people

  • Reliable, punctual, and consistent

 

Availability

  • Workshops run at least 4 days per week:
    Tuesday, Wednesday, Thursday, Friday, Saturday, and Sunday

  • Availability to work 2-5 days a week, including weekends

 

Training & Interview Process

  • Training is provided for tools, workshop flow, and safety

  • Shortlisted candidates will complete a paid trial shift as part of the interview process

 

Compensation

  • Hourly rate to be shared during the interview process

 

Physical & Environmental Considerations

  • Standing for extended periods

  • Working around heat, sparks, and noise

  • Lifting and moving tools and materials

 

What Success Looks Like

  • Participants feel supported, safe, and confident throughout the workshop

  • Workshops run smoothly behind the scenes with strong support for instructors and overall flow

  • Tools, materials, and supplies are consistently organized, maintained, and ready for use

  • Proactively identifies when tools or materials need replenishing, maintenance, or repair

  • Demonstrates and models strong safety practices at all times
